Possible Causes of Water Damage in Orange, CA

Water damage can occur suddenly or gradually, often stemming from various unforeseen issues. In Orange, CA, common causes include plumbing failures, such as burst pipes or leaking fixtures, which can overwhelm your plumbing system. Additionally, weather-related incidents like heavy rains or storms can lead to roof leaks or basement flooding, causing significant water intrusion. Poorly maintained drainage systems and clogged gutters are also frequent culprits, allowing water to seep into your property during storms.

Other causes may involve appliance malfunctions, like washing machines or water heaters malfunctioning and causing localized flooding. Sometimes, structural damages such as foundation cracks or improperly sealed windows allow groundwater to penetrate your building. Regardless of the source, water intrusion can quickly lead to extensive damage if not addressed promptly. Recognizing these potential causes helps in preventing long-term issues and preparing for effective remediation.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the common signs of water damage in my property?

Visible water stains, musty odors, and warping floors or walls are typical signs. If you notice unexplained dampness or peeling paint, it’s time to call professionals for an assessment.

How long does water damage classification and restoration usually take?

The duration varies based on the extent of damage. Minor leaks may be resolved within a few hours, while extensive flooding could take several days. Our team works efficiently to minimize disruption and restore your property promptly.

Can I handle water damage cleanup myself?

While minor issues might be manageable, professional help is essential for thorough cleaning, drying, and mold prevention. Our experts ensure your property is safely and properly restored to prevent future problems.

What should I do immediately after discovering water damage?
